Understanding the Monsoon Season
What is the Monsoon?
The term “monsoon” refers to a seasonal change in the direction of the prevailing winds in a region, leading to significant changes in weather patterns. The monsoon is typically characterized by heavy rainfall, especially in tropical and subtropical regions. It occurs due to the differential heating of land and sea, which creates pressure differences that drive the winds.
The Global Monsoon Cycle
Monsoon season are not limited to a single region but occur in various parts of the world. The most notable monsoons include the South Asian Monsoon, the East Asian Monsoon, and the West African Monsoon. Each of these systems is driven by complex atmospheric processes and interacts with local geography to produce rainfall patterns that can be both beneficial and destructive.
The Relationship Between Monsoon and Flooding
Causes of Flooding During Monsoon
Flooding during the monsoon season is primarily caused by the excessive and prolonged rainfall that overwhelms rivers, lakes, and drainage systems. The following factors contribute to the increased risk of flooding:
- Heavy Rainfall: The monsoon brings intense and sustained rainfall, which can quickly saturate the ground, leading to surface runoff and the overflowing of rivers.
- Poor Drainage Systems: In many regions, inadequate drainage infrastructure exacerbates the problem, as water cannot be efficiently channeled away, causing urban and rural flooding.
- Deforestation and Urbanization: Human activities such as deforestation and rapid urbanization reduce the land’s ability to absorb water, increasing the likelihood of floods.
Types of Floods
Floods during the monsoon season can take various forms, depending on the geography and the intensity of the rainfall:
- River Floods: Occur when rivers overflow their banks, often affecting large areas and leading to widespread displacement of people and damage to property.
- Flash Floods: Sudden and severe floods that occur with little warning, usually in areas with poor drainage or steep terrain.
- Urban Floods: Result from inadequate drainage in cities, where the heavy rainfall overwhelms the infrastructure, leading to waterlogged streets and submerged buildings.
Impact of Flooding on Communities
Human and Economic Losses
Flooding during the monsoon season can have devastating effects on communities. The human toll includes loss of life, injuries, and displacement. The economic impact is equally severe, with damage to homes, businesses, infrastructure, and agricultural land. In many cases, recovery can take years, and the financial burden can be overwhelming for affected regions.
Health Risks
Flooding also poses significant health risks, including the spread of waterborne diseases such as cholera, dysentery, and typhoid. Contaminated water supplies and poor sanitation conditions can lead to outbreaks, particularly in densely populated areas. Additionally, standing water creates breeding grounds for mosquitoes, increasing the risk of malaria and dengue fever.
Environmental Consequences
The environmental impact of flooding can be profound. Floodwaters can erode soil, destroy crops, and disrupt ecosystems. In some cases, flooding can lead to long-term changes in the landscape, such as the creation of new river channels or the destruction of wetlands. These changes can have lasting effects on local wildlife and vegetation.
Mitigating the Impact of Flooding
Flood Management Strategies
To reduce the Monsoon Season and its impact on flooding, various flood management strategies can be implemented:
- Improved Drainage Systems: Enhancing urban and rural drainage infrastructure can help channel water away from populated areas, reducing the risk of floods.
- River Management: Controlling river levels through dams, levees, and embankments can prevent rivers from overflowing during heavy rainfall.
- Early Warning Systems: Implementing early warning systems and emergency response plans can save lives by providing timely information and guidance to affected communities.
Community Preparedness
Educating communities about the risks of flooding and promoting preparedness measures is crucial. This includes raising awareness about evacuation routes, emergency supplies, and safe shelter locations. Community involvement in flood preparedness efforts can significantly reduce the impact of floods.
Environmental Conservation
Protecting natural ecosystems, such as forests and wetlands, can also play a role in mitigating flood risks. These areas act as natural buffers, absorbing excess water and reducing the likelihood of floods. Reforestation and sustainable land use practices are essential components of long-term flood management.
